About this item

  • Precision Brand Music Wire is spring tempered and made from high carbon steel alloy
  • High tensile strength and high fatigue resistance
  • Applications include springs, wire forms, control linkages, armature binding, ceramic cutting, and a variety of industrial uses
  • Tensile strength - 293-323 ksi (min. - max.)
  • 1lb Coil


Packaged wire is shrink wrapped, bar coded, and packaged in an easy to use pull-type dispenser box.

Read the write up carefully. I looked up Mechanics Wire and this came up. It is NOT MECHANICS wire it is MUSIC WIRE. That means it is HARDENED. It is not pliable nor is it easily bendable. It's hardened and will truly be a challenge for you to cut with conventional pliers. Electricians side cutters are your best bet and they better be a name brand like Klein, Ideal or Channellock and not from Harbor Freight or it will dull the blades on contact. Not what I thought I was buying but it is listed in the description. My bad for not reading the description more carefully.
